Sometimes the key to surviving a hot afternoon is the perfect glass of lemonade. I learned this recently at a farmer’s market where I came across an amazing raspberry lemonade. It can be life changing! Brewing the perfect lemonade at home is easy, with a few tips:
1. Start with a simple syrup: boil equal parts water and sugar until dissolved. Optional: add lemon zest to the syrup as it cools and strain with a fine-mesh sieve. 2. Add fresh lemon juice and about 1 cup of cold water for each lemon used - test until you are happy with the level of sweetness. A rule of thumb is about 3 lemons for each 1/2 cup of simple syrup. 3. Dress it up! Add lime or orange juice, pureed and strained fruit like strawberries and raspberries, or more exotic flavors like ginger root and dried lavender flowers (very French!).
